Traditional Copywriting vs SEO Copywriting

Traditional copywriting and SEO copywriting serve distinct yet interconnected purposes. Traditional copywriting prioritises creativity, emotional resonance, and brand voice to make a lasting impression on the audience.

While maintaining those principles, SEO copywriting takes it a step further by optimising content for search engines. It is about blending compelling storytelling with strategic use of keywords and formatting techniques like headers, meta descriptions, and internal links. The goal is to rank higher in search engine results, increasing visibility and attracting organic traffic.

Both forms of copywriting aim to connect with readers, but SEO copywriting has the added layer of appealing to algorithms, ensuring that the content not only resonates with humans but also aligns with the technical requirements of online platforms.

 you begin crafting content, it is important to understand why people are searching for particular terms. What is driving their search? Are they seeking information, browsing for options, or ready to make a purchase?

Search intent generally falls into four main categories: informational, navigational, transactional, and commercial investigation.

  • Informational Intent- This is when users are searching purely to learn something or gather knowledge, without any immediate plan to buy or take further action.
  • Navigational Intent- Here, users are aiming to locate a specific website or page. They already know where they want to go but use search engines as a shortcut.
  • Transactional Intent- When users have transactional intent, they are ready to take a specific action, whether it is making a purchase, signing up for a service, or downloading an app.
  • Commercial Investigation Intent- These users are close to making a decision but are still weighing up their options. They might be comparing products, reading reviews, or hunting for the best deal.
  1. Craft Compelling Headlines

Your headline serves as the first impression of your content, and it plays an important role in both user engagement and search engine ranking. To craft a headline that resonates with your audience and optimises for search engines, consider these key points:

  • Be clear and informative- The headline should immediately communicate what the article is about while incorporating target keywords naturally.
  • Spark curiosity or address a pain point- Headlines that promise a solution to a specific problem or offer a unique perspective tend to attract more clicks.
  • Keep it under 60 characters- Headlines longer than 60 characters may get truncated in search engine results.

Let's have an example headline:

5 Ways to Grow Your Business in Australia Through Social Media

This headline is clear, informative, and to the point. It offers actionable tips ("5 Ways") and specifies the target audience (business owners in Australia). The mention of "Social Media" not only makes it relevant to current marketing trends but also targets a specific, high-volume keyword. It also stays within the optimal character length to ensure it isn't cut off in search results.

  1. Speak Your Audience’s Language

Using terminology your audience understands is key. Avoid industry jargon unless you are addressing experts who value technical precision. Instead, focus on using clear, accessible language that aligns with their knowledge level and interests.

For example, if you are writing about fitness products for Gen Z, you wouldn’t say: "Our performance-enhancing supplements are formulated with cutting-edge bioactive compounds to optimise athletic recovery."

Instead, try: "Need faster recovery after your workouts? Our supplements are packed with natural ingredients to help your muscles bounce back, so you can hit it hard again tomorrow."

Gen Z appreciates clear, direct language that speaks to their lifestyle and concerns. They are often looking for products or tips that make their lives easier, more sustainable, or more fun.

  1. Use Internal Links With Optimised Anchor Text

Guide readers through your site by linking to relevant pages using descriptive anchor text. Instead of using generic anchor text like "click here", use descriptive phrases that provide both context and value to your readers.

Instead of saying: "For more information about the best practices for website accessibility, click here."

You could write: "To discover the best practices for improving website accessibility and ensure your site is user-friendly for all visitors, check out our detailed guide.”

  1. Link to High-Quality External Pages

Make sure the external sources you use are reliable and relevant. Search engines are informed that your content has been carefully examined when you link to reliable websites. Also, it benefits your viewers by offering more reliable resources.

For example, if your content discusses climate change, you could link to a government body or a well-established environmental organisation like The Australian Conservation Foundation or Climate Council.

Optimise Your Meta Tags

Your meta title and description are the first thing searchers see when they come across your page in search results. While meta tags themselves don’t directly impact rankings, they improve your click-through rates, which can indirectly influence your search engine performance.

For example, your meta title is "Website Audit Checklist for the New Year | Boost Your SEO in 2024"

Meta Description: Ready to kick off the new year with a fresh website audit? Our comprehensive checklist helps you optimise your site for better SEO performance and user experience in 2024. Start today!

By including targeted keywords like "Website Audit," "SEO," and "New Year," and offering a clear value proposition, these meta tags not only align with search intent but also encourage users to click through to your content.
